I did some work in poser myself... very cool program. Elbows and such gets a little weird in some positions; it takes a lot of small adjustments to get things to look right.

About textures. I am not sure what you use, but I found that using a math filter to turn them black and white (desaturation) and then combining (blend or add) it with a plain color texture gets the shading and features right even with unusual skin colors - and you can do that in-engine, which is definitely a bonus when you play around with it. It does loose you the other colors on the texture, though (lips or such) - fortunately many of the features have their own maps.

I don't have poser installed or I could give you the references with proper names on how to do it. As is, my memory fails me. :(
